Christy Timm Fulkerson

Christy Timm Fulkerson, Ph.D., CCC-SLP, is an assistant professor whose work centers on language and literacy development in young children. Her research examines language-based risk factors for early literacy difficulties, with a particular focus on bilingual learners and children at risk for developmental language disorder. She is especially interested in improving early identification through more accurate and culturally responsive assessment and screening practices, as well as strengthening the capacity of families, educators, and clinicians who support children’s language and literacy development.

Prior to her academic career, Dr. Timm Fulkerson worked as a speech-language pathologist in early intervention, elementary, and middle school settings. This applied clinical experience informs her teaching and research, with an emphasis on supporting children, educators, and families in the practical application of evidence-based practices. Across her work, she is committed to bridging science and practice to promote effective and sustainable support for children and families.
